window.onload=function(){
   
   //テキストサイズ変更
   $('.text-size ul li').click(function(){
      
      if($(this).hasClass('larger')){
         $('body').css('font-size','14px');
      }else if($(this).hasClass('large')){
         $('body').css('font-size','18px');
      }else{
         $('body').css('font-size','12px');
      }
      
      $('.text-size ul li').removeClass('on');
      $(this).addClass('on');
   });
   
   //リスト要素を交互にクラス指定(odd,even)
   $('table.stripe tr:nth-child(odd)').addClass("odd");
   $('table.stripe tr:nth-child(even)').addClass("even");
   $('ul.stripe li:odd').addClass("odd");
   $('ul.stripe li:even').addClass("even");
   
   //下層サブメニューロールオーバー
   /*
     ロールオーバー時に表示する画像名は hoge-over.gif みたいな感じで「-over」をつける
     画像がgifの場合のクラスはcontents-menu、jpgの場合はcontents-menu2
   */
   $('#contents-title .contents-menu li a').hover(function(){
      if(!$(this).hasClass('this')){
         var src = $('img', this).attr('src').split('.gif')[0]+"-over.gif";
         $('img', this).attr('src',src);
      }
   },function(){
      var src = $('img', this).attr('src').split('-over.gif')[0]+".gif";
      $('img', this).attr('src',src);
   });
   $('#contents-title .contents-menu2 li a').hover(function(){
      if(!$(this).hasClass('this')){
         var src = $('img', this).attr('src').split('.jpg')[0]+"-over.jpg";
         $('img', this).attr('src',src);
      }
   },function(){
      var src = $('img', this).attr('src').split('-over.jpg')[0]+".jpg";
      $('img', this).attr('src',src);
   });
   
}



